About Hubballi (2006) — A forgotten stranger, a family's sacrifice, and the mystery of lost memory
In Hubballi (2006), a gritty action-drama from director Om Prakash Rao, a mysterious stranger lies near death on a quiet Indian street before being rescued by a retired army officer and his devoted daughter. As the stranger fights his way back to health, he awakens with no memory of his past—a gaping void that tests the limits of trust and human connection.
The film weaves a tense narrative around themes of identity, redemption, and second chances, set against a backdrop of suspense and emotional depth. With Sudeepa delivering a standout performance alongside Rakshita's heartfelt portrayal, Hubballi blends rugged action with poignant drama to explore whether lost memories can ever truly be restored.
